Originally Posted by mkguitar
Looking at doping similar at the rear, I have the detachable tour pak kit coming and want to "slenderize" the rear- also moving the license plate to under the taillight---kinda like the flhx

Nice Job, Mike
I think w/the kit you'll get the tag bracket relocation stuff. I ordered the 4-pt docking hardware and the detach tour pak bracket only, then realized I was missing the shock strut covers and the tag bracket. I had planned to do the bullet rear TS, but I bought the wrong Street Glide/Road Glide housing on the first try - didn't have the inner holes to mount the tag bracket underneath. Ended up getting the correct housing off Zinotti website and re-attaching the bullets. Used the Kuryakyn curved license plate frame. My TS have red lenses because PO had installed the rear brake lite module. Oh, and I had to buy the strut covers separately, ended up going w/black instead of chrome.
